The Moat.

The official abode of Bishop of Bath and Wells is the Bishops Palace, Wells, in Somerset,

Construction began around 1210 under Bishop Jocelin. The palace features medieval architecture, including a vaulted Undercroft, the Long Gallery, and the ruins of the Great Hall. It sits within a moat (with resident mute swans) and includes springs that gave the city of Wells its name.
